Game Overview and Release Details

The highly anticipated real-time tactics revival, Commandos Origins, marks its global debut on April 9, 2025, bringing classic strategic gameplay to modern systems. Currently available for pre-order across three distinct editions, the game offers varying content packages but notably excludes early access privileges regardless of purchase tier. Minimum System Requirements Analysis
Minimum system requirements:
-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
- OS: Windows 10 (64-bit)
- Processor: i5-4690K / Ryzen 7 2700
- Graphics: GeForce GTX 970 / Radeon RX 580
- Storage: 31 GB available space
- Sound Card: Integrated or dedicated compatible soundcard
- Additional Notes: Low settings | Full-HD | Average performance | SSD recommended | Upscaling via FSR available
The minimum specifications target functional gameplay rather than visual excellence, positioning Commandos Origins as accessible to gamers with older hardware. The processor requirements indicate good multi-core optimization, with both Intel and AMD options from approximately 2014-2017 providing adequate performance. Graphics capabilities focus on delivering stable frame rates at 1080p resolution with reduced visual fidelity.
Critical performance notes emphasize that average performance at low settings should be expected, making this configuration suitable for gameplay-focused users who prioritize tactical decision-making over graphical splendor. The FSR upscaling support provides valuable performance headroom for systems struggling to maintain consistent frame rates during intensive combat sequences.
Recommended System Requirements Breakdown
Recommended system requirements:
-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
- OS: Windows 10 (64-bit)
- Processor: i7-9700 / Ryzen 7 3700X
- Graphics: GeForce RTX 3060 / Radeon RX 6600 XT
- Storage: 31 GB available space
- Sound Card: Integrated or dedicated compatible soundcard
- Additional Notes: Medium settings | Full-HD | Average performance | SSD recommended | Upscaling via DLSS or FSR available
The recommended configuration delivers the authentic Commandos Origins experience with balanced performance and visual quality. The processor upgrades to more recent generations demonstrate the game’s utilization of additional cores and threads for complex AI calculations and environmental interactions. Graphics requirements jump significantly to accommodate the game’s detailed textures, lighting effects, and larger unit counts.
Notably, the recommended specs include support for both DLSS and FSR upscaling technologies, providing flexibility for users with NVIDIA or AMD hardware to maximize performance without sacrificing visual clarity. The continued emphasis on SSD storage underscores its importance for seamless gameplay in mission-based tactical games where level transitions and save/load operations occur frequently.
These specifications target medium settings at Full HD resolution, suggesting that high or ultra settings may require even more powerful hardware for optimal performance, particularly during complex multi-squad engagements with extensive environmental destruction and particle effects.
Advanced Optimization Strategies
Beyond meeting the basic specifications, several optimization strategies can significantly enhance your Commandos Origins experience. Solid-state drive installation remains the most impactful upgrade for this genre, reducing mission loading times from minutes to seconds and ensuring smooth asset streaming during complex tactical operations.
Understanding the upscaling options proves crucial for performance tuning. FSR (FidelityFX Super Resolution) provides broad compatibility across GPU brands, while DLSS (Deep Learning Super Sampling) offers superior image reconstruction for RTX series owners. Strategic use of these technologies can boost frame rates by 30-50% while maintaining visual quality, particularly important during large-scale engagements.
Memory configuration deserves special attention—while 8GB meets minimum requirements, upgrading to 16GB eliminates potential stuttering when managing multiple squads across expansive maps. For enthusiasts seeking maximum performance, ensuring dual-channel memory configuration and adequate cooling for sustained boost clocks during extended gaming sessions provides noticeable improvements in consistent frame pacing.
Pro tip: Monitor your VRAM usage closely, as tactical games with detailed environments can quickly exhaust graphics memory, causing significant performance degradation. The recommended RTX 3060’s 12GB VRAM provides comfortable headroom for higher resolution textures and effects.
